Shaped by centuries-old volcanic eruptions, Camiguin is known as the Island Born of Fire. Fourteen volcanos exist (Philvolcs number) on a single island, one remains on the active list. The volcanic island has so much to offer including black sand beaches (the result of eruptions), a sunken cemetery now overgrown with coral after sinking into the ocean in 1871, thriving reefs, and a striking white sandbar which we have pleasure of swimming to or from on race day.

A modern national road runs the circumference of the island, a total of 60Km around. Guests can also explore waterfalls, hike up dormant volcanos, and sample the surprising variety of restaurants.
